read the original abstract

We show that the dispersionless limits of the Pfaff-KP (also known as the DKP or Pfaff lattice) and the Pfaff-Toda hierarchies admit a reformulation through elliptic functions. In the elliptic form they look like natural elliptic deformations of the KP and 2D Toda hierarchy respectively.
